Output 32fa942863739dcdacd080498845476b3154f685579561d0351304ad5ea50194:101
- value
- 2242073
- script pubkey
- OP_0 OP_PUSHBYTES_20 59efbc770ed2c379f2ecc5b93a8639933dab458a
- address
- bc1qt8hmcacw6tphnuhvckun4p3ejv76k3v22pf64p
- transaction
- 32fa942863739dcdacd080498845476b3154f685579561d0351304ad5ea50194